What Are PLA Straws?

From Plants to Products

PLA, or polylactic acid, is a bioplastic derived from fermented plant starch—most commonly from corn or sugarcane. Unlike traditional petroleum-based plastics, PLA is both renewable and biodegradable under industrial composting conditions. This makes it a compelling solution for disposable products like straws, cutlery, and packaging.

PLA straws look and feel like their plastic counterparts but come with a significantly smaller environmental footprint. They decompose into natural elements within months under the right conditions, leaving no toxic residue.

Challenges and Misconceptions

Composting Isn’t Always Simple

One common misconception is that PLA straws can decompose in a backyard compost. In reality, they require industrial composting facilities with specific temperature and humidity conditions. Without proper disposal systems, the benefits of PLA can be diminished.
